Output df56a323ffdb6c90091aafeb741130ee4a02d1a09cccc1eac6525f45da431789:104
- value
- 26428
- script pubkey
- OP_0 OP_PUSHBYTES_20 8530897bacf9d805d3e7f2ce6b388a0c93d788ba
- address
- bc1qs5cgj7avl8vqt5l87t8xkwy2pjfa0z96vy9zuu
- transaction
- df56a323ffdb6c90091aafeb741130ee4a02d1a09cccc1eac6525f45da431789